Recently I purchased about $50 in groceries and a $50 Disney card. I had about $80 in gift cards (several cards). At self check out I was scanning each card. Once my gift card values went over the amount of my groceries, the register gave a warning and it required a cashier to come over and unlock it. It told the cashier my gift card balance exceeded my other items or something to that effect (cashier looked at it for a split second and over road it so I didn't see exact wording). I was able to in effect, buy a gift card with a gift card. It may work for you, it may not. Point being, the register will flag it and require a second look by an employee.
Can it be done. Yes. Would it be easy to buy $1000 worth of Disney cards at self check out with just Target cards? Not likely.
